Removing, Installing, and Replacing Components 39 Removing a Slot Cover You remove a slot cover when you install an add-in card that occupies a previously-empty slot. ! Before opening the system unit, save and close all open files, exit all open applications, turn off the power to all attached peripheral devices, shut down the computer, and unplug the power cord. 1 Remove the side cover (see "Removing the Side Cover" on page 24). 2 Locate the slot whose cover you want to remove. 3 Lay the system on its side. 4 Remove the screw from the slot cover. 5 Remove the loose slot cover and retain it for future use.
